Output 51f8cb1f2f4b74c654b43beae0c8247bf8c1c7830bdbd64ab9e5a271e041261d:45

value
593836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24f0550a7d8cbd69262a81fc2725a8d2b3b74ea0 OP_EQUAL
address
354LA2HnWrdDaUFaoFtFMg7vieyaPKSaK1
transaction
51f8cb1f2f4b74c654b43beae0c8247bf8c1c7830bdbd64ab9e5a271e041261d
spent
true